Expecting a very strong tempo with lots of early pressure, predominantly from Be Merry, Hear My Voice and Dafnes Daughter. LOVE SHACK (5) has good consistent form lines to her credit. She moved up like a winner over this course and distance last time, but was outrun late. Despite carrying top weight, she should be the one to beat. BE MERRY (1) showed good speed when winning her last start over this course and distance. She takes on stronger rivals but should be up to the task at hand. PALO QUEEN (10) finished 11th last time out over 1000m at this track. Has the gate speed to take up a forward position and rates well as an each-way chance. EASY MONEY (6) returned from a spell last start with a strong win by a head over 1000m at this track. Open to plenty of improvement and is among the better chances.
